Might come to Ecuador. What to know? by thetreegeek in ecuador

[–]RepresentativeLost70 1 point2 points  (0 children)

People are still wearing masks, it seems to be getting more lax lately but still lots of masks. It is enforced indoors. Some places ask for vaccine cards and two vaccines. A couple places have even asked for id to verify identity. The vaccine card thing has been pretty relaxed the last few weeks, at least for me. I have only been asked once or twice lately.

To get in the country you just need the vaccine card.
